azjc 06.27.2008 01:30 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by DiFabio42 (Post 186050)
Sweet. TrueRC 6s 8000mAh Lipo is $210.00. Nice deal. I'm getting that battery.

just a heads up the 6s 8000 is a very big battery I have a 6s 5000 and I was surprised how big it was when I got it, and the charger you have a link to is the ac/dc battery I was suggesting but I didnt since you wanted to keep the price below $100, and its out put is only 50 watts...you would need about 200 watts to charge the 6s 8000 in an hour so you would be looking at 4hrs to charge that pack

azjc 06.27.2008 01:58 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by DiFabio42 (Post 186069)
http://www.impaktrc.com/product_info...oducts_id=2058

That's 250 Watts.

What power supply can I use with that?

I have that charger and its great, you were sayinh=g you wanted to keep the price down or that would have been my first choice to suggest, I run the ofna 14v 18 amp PS and its good here is a link


http://www.impaktrc.com/product_info...oducts_id=2428

just make sure the PS is a switching type the power is clean without spikes and you will be fine

that PS puts out 252 watts and you will need to factor in 20% for effiency and that takes you down to 200 watts ...so thats is the smallest PS I would go with if you want to charge the 6s 8000 pack, but when you run higher voltage you dont need such a big pack escpecially when you run a lower kv motor
